This book presents a refreshing take on personal transformation through the lens of classical rhetoric. Drawing from Jay Heinrichs' work and rooted in Aristotle's foundational principles, it explores how the ancient art of persuasion can become a practical, everyday philosophy for living with clarity, conviction, and purpose. Rather than viewing persuasion as a means to influence others, Gabriele Achen turns the focus inward--showing how self-persuasion can lead to deeper self-awareness, stronger decision-making, and a more intentional life. Through the timeless pillars of ethos, pathos, and logos, the reader is invited to discover how aligning thought, emotion, and credibility can bring harmony to how we speak, act, and relate to others. This is not a manual for argumentation. It's a thoughtful guide for anyone seeking to better understand themselves and move through the world with integrity and insight. With a grounded and human approach, Jay Heinrich's Performative Book offers an inspiring path to personal growth, rooted in ancient wisdom yet strikingly relevant to modern life.
